Government must dangle carrots as well as wave stick to speed take up on electric LCVs
A record year for EVs. A record year for home deliveries. What comes next?
Ideally, the electric van boom. Up until recently, electric LCVs (e-LCVs) were considered somewhat of a fantasy. Batteries weren’t powerful enough – and were too big and cumbersome – to allow for proper cargo transportation.
But manufacturers have since cracked those problems.
Advancements in battery technology have made electric LCVs just as viable as electric cars, and as such, there’s a growing number of models available. […][1]
